HMC913-Die Series
The HMC913 is a Successive Detection Log Video Amplifier (SDLVA) which operates from 0.6 to 20 GHz. The HMC913 provides a logging range of 59 dB. This device offers typical fast rise/fall times of 5/10 ns and a superior delay time of only 14 ns. The HMC913 log video output slope is typically 14 mV/dB. Maximum recovery times are less than 30 ns. Ideal for high speed channelized receiver applications, the HMC913 operates from a single +3.3 V supply, and consumes only 80 mA.
